网线
网络双绞线是两根铜线绞在一起,作用是用来抵御外界电磁波干扰。双绞线的有效距离最长是100米,多余100米信号会衰减,不能和强电放在一起,因为强电会干扰弱电信号,有“屏蔽”和“非屏蔽”双绞线。
网线类型:5类线(cat.5):适应于100MB网络,市场主流。
超5类线(cat.5e):衰减少,支持千兆网。
6类线(cat.6):用于千兆网,抗衰减更强。
超6类线:(cat.6a):加强抗衰减。
7类线:屏蔽双绞线,万兆网,外观上很粗。
光纤:通过光的全反射,很快(囧)。
线序有T568A和T568B线序。一般常用T568B
T568A:白绿、绿;白橙、蓝;白蓝、橙;白棕、棕
T568B:白橙、橙;白绿、蓝;白蓝、绿;白棕、棕
八根线中只有1、2、3、6有用
管叫号 用途 颜色
1 发送+ 白绿
2 发送- 绿
3 接收+ 白橙
6 接收- 橙
直通线:T568B~T568B
全反线:用于配置、连接交换机~棕、白棕;绿……
交叉线:T568A~T568B
交换机
MAC地址是由十六进制表示的 比如 00-D0-09-A1-D7-B7,前24位是厂商向IEEE申请的厂商标识符, MAC分为6组,每组换成二进制是8位,6组就是48位,第8位为0时,是一个单播地址(物理地址),如果为1时是一个逻辑地址(组播地址),一个网卡的地址都是单播地址。
交换机中有一个MAC地址表,对应着计算机的MAC地址和交换机相连的端口号。
1、MAC地址学习
例如 主机A去找主机B,交换机首先查询MAC地址表中1接口对应的源MAC条目。如果条目中没有源MAC地址,交换机会把A的mac地址和所对应的交换机接口编号1对应起来,保存到MAC地址表中。
2、广播未知数据帧
如果交换机中的地址表中没有找到目的地址所对应的条目,交换机就开始广播,除了1口外,所以接口都会收到这个广播
3、接收方回应信息
主机B会回应这个广播,回应一个数据帧(源MAC地址为B,目标MAC地址为A),这时候交换机会把主机B的MAC和接口号2口对应起来保存到MAC地址表中
4、交换机实现单播通信
当主机A和主机B再通信是就不用广播了,会从MAC地址表中找到B的MAC和接口直接发送数据帧
交换机四个模式:用户模式、特权模式、全局模式、接口模式。
1、用户模式:查看一些系统信息。switch>
end:从接口模式转入到特权模式;exit:逐步退出
Switch> show version→显示系统信息命令
2、特权模式:查看设备配置。switch#
在用户模式下输入“enable/en”进入特权模式→switch>enable
此模式可以使用的命令:
show ip int bri #看接口信息,可以查看交换机的哪些接口被使用,如果被使用了,该接口的状态就是up。不被使用,接口的状态就是down。
show running-config #查看运行时配置。例如,可以查看交换机名字,配置的特权模式密码,通过console口本地登录的密码。
vlan database #创建vlan。
Switch#vlan database
Switch(vlan)#vlan 20 name test20 #添加vlan并且命名vlan20为test20
VLAN 20 added:
Name: test20
Switch(vlan)#no vlan20 #删除vlan20
show vlan #查看vlan
3、全局模式:对整个交换机修改配置参数。switch(config)#
在特权模式下输入“config terminal/conf t”→switch#config terminal
配置VTY密码(配置远程登录密码)
Switch(config)#line vty 0 4 #为0-4五个线路配置远程登录密码,即可以同时允许5个终端远程连接。line vty 0 ?可以查看交换机支持几个线路。
Switch(config-line)#password 123
Switch(config-line)#login
Switch(config)#enable password 123 #在全局模式下给特权模式配置密码。
计算机远程登录
telnet 192.168.1.1 ,输入VTY密码,然后在输入特权模式密码
配置vlan
全局模式 : 不仅支持vlan正常范围,可以配置
命令
Switch(config)#vlan 10
Switch(config-vlan)#name test10
Switch(config)#no vlan 10 #删除vlan10
4、接口模式:针对设备的接口修改参数。switch(config-if)#
在特权模式下输入“interface fastethernet 0/1”或“int f0/1”进入0/1接口。
→switch(config)# interface fastethernet 0/1
Switch(config-if)#switchport access vlan 10 把0/1口加入到vlan10中